This property is located in the London Borough of Waltham Forest, a district that combines suburban character with proximity to central London.
Waltham Forest London Borough Council, also known as Waltham Forest Council, is the local authority for the London Borough of Waltham Forest in London. The London Borough of Waltham Forest is an outer London borough formed in 1965 from the merger of the Essex municipal boroughs of Leyton, Walthamstow and Chingford. The council provides local services and governance for the area, which includes a range of residential neighbourhoods and community facilities. Residents in Waltham Forest benefit from the borough’s council services and the local identity that emerged from its historical roots in the former municipal boroughs. The borough’s formation in 1965 marked a consolidation of local governance, aiming to support the growing suburban population in this part of London.
